Russia's Gazprom to buy Kyrgyz state gas company

BISHKEK, Kyrgyzstan (AP) — Kyrgyzstan's state-owned natural gas company says it is to be sold in its entirety to Russian energy giant Gazprom.Kyrgyzgaz general director Turgunbek Kulmurzayev said Friday that the sale of the company would be completed by April 1.The takeover will raise hopes that the Central Asian nation may not continue to experience debilitating energy shortages like those it has...

Study: Solo stars at higher death risk than bands

LONDON (AP) — Rock 'n' roll will never die — but it's a hazardous occupation.A new study confirms that rock and pop musicians die prematurely more often than the general population, and an early death is twice as likely for solo musicians as for members of bands.Researchers from Liverpool John Moores University studied 1,489 rock and pop stars who became famous between 1956 and 2009 and found they...

Dictator's daughter has lead in SKorea vote

SEOUL, South Korea (AP) — The daughter of a late dictator held a slight lead Wednesday in early vote counts for South Korea's presidential election, setting up the possibility that the deeply conservative country will get its first female leader.With about 64 percent of the votes counted, Park Geun-hye had 51.7 percent of votes while her opponent Moon Jae-in had 47.8 percent, according to the state-run...
